Waiting times for diagnostic tests for bladder and prostate cancer have been drastically reduced after services were redesigned.
Patients were waiting more than two years to be seen but a purpose built Urology Hub at Forth Valley Royal Hospital has seen that fall to a few months.
Nurses have been trained to perform diagnostic procedures in a bid to clear the backlog- much of it is due to services being disrupted by the pandemic. As Caroline Lewis reports.
